AI Technical Summary
Existing cargo transport equipment is difficult to effectively secure irregularly shaped objects, causing items to slide or roll, increasing the risk of damage and reducing transport efficiency. Furthermore, filling with foam material is wasteful of resources and reduces efficiency.
Featuring an adjustable fixing rod and limit rod design, combined with springs and graduated grooves, it allows for dynamic adjustment of the fixing point to accommodate items of different shapes and sizes; the support block and bidirectional lead screw can adjust the footprint and stability.
It improves the fixation and stability of irregularly shaped objects, prevents movement and damage during transportation, reduces resource waste, and improves transportation efficiency and safety.

TECHNICAL FIELD
[0001] The utility model relates to goods transport device technical field especially easy to fix the goods transport device of special -shaped article. BACKGROUND
[0002] The utility model discloses a kind of goods transport devices, it includes transport plate and at least two support legs. Transport plate extends along longitudinal direction and has longitudinally opposite first end and second end, also include upper side and lower side, wherein goods can be placed on the upper side of the transport plate;At least two support legs are fixedly installed to the lower side of the transport plate along the longitudinal direction of the transport plate, at least two the support legs include the first support leg and the second support leg of equal vertical height, the first support leg is arranged vertically below the first end of the transport plate, the second support leg is arranged vertically below the second end of the transport plate, wherein at least one of the first support leg and the second support leg is detachably attached to the lower side of the transport plate.Using the goods transport device with the above configuration, goods can easily slide off the transport plate, the whole unloading process saves time and effort, and safety is high, most conventional devices use fixed, non-adjustable fixing mechanism, which results in their inability to effectively adapt to diverse shapes of articles, so that in actual transportation process, articles are prone to sliding or tumbling, causing damage or loss, increasing the risk of operation complexity and article damage, not only reducing transportation efficiency, but also possibly leading to higher logistics processing cost and safety risk, and for some articles, transportation is carried out by filling foam or the like in the gap, which is relatively wasteful of resources, and the foam also needs to be cut, reducing overall efficiency, which needs to be improved. [0024] Working principle: first, the operator needs to accurately adjust the fixed rod 2 located around the mounting plate 1 according to the size and shape of the object to be fixed. In order to facilitate operation, a scale groove 4 is provided on each fixed rod 2, so that the operator can accurately observe the position of the fixed rod 2 and ensure that the adjustment is as required. At the same time, the rubber anti-skid block 3 installed on the fixed rod 2 improves the friction force when contacting the object, greatly enhancing the stability of the object during the fixing process. After the position of the fixed rod 2 is adjusted, the operator pulls the limiting rod 7 by pushing the plate 8, so that the limiting rod 7 slides inside the fixed rod 2 to the appropriate position. By applying force through the pushing plate 8, the movement of the limiting rod 7 can be accurately controlled, thereby adjusting the position of the fixed rod 2. Then, the limiting rod 7 is driven by the spring 9 to slide into the fixed rod 2, achieving accurate fixing of the object. The limiting rod 7 enters the limiting slot 10 on the fixed rod 2, ensuring that the fixed rod 2 can be accurately clamped at any position inside the mounting plate 1, adapting to different shapes of objects and enhancing the fixing effect. The bidirectional screw rod 13 and the rotating head 14 are controlled, and the operator can adjust these components to move the sliding frame 15 and the supporting block 11, adjust the width of the mounting plate 1 to adapt to different transportation equipment, and increase the floor area to maintain stability.
